Udostępnij za pośrednictwem


DelegatingConfigHost.EncryptSection Metoda

Definicja

Szyfruje sekcję obiektu konfiguracji.

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u.

public:
 virtual System::String ^ EncryptSection(System::String ^ clearTextXml, System::Configuration::ProtectedConfigurationProvider ^ protectionProvider, System::Configuration::ProtectedConfigurationSection ^ protectedConfigSection);
public virtual string EncryptSection (string clearTextXml, System.Configuration.ProtectedConfigurationProvider protectionProvider, System.Configuration.ProtectedConfigurationSection protectedConfigSection);
abstract member EncryptSection : string * System.Configuration.ProtectedConfigurationProvider * System.Configuration.ProtectedConfigurationSection -> string
override this.EncryptSection : string * System.Configuration.ProtectedConfigurationProvider * System.Configuration.ProtectedConfigurationSection -> string
Public Overridable Function EncryptSection (clearTextXml As String, protectionProvider As ProtectedConfigurationProvider, protectedConfigSection As ProtectedConfigurationSection) As String

Parametry

clearTextXml
String

Sekcja konfiguracji, która nie jest szyfrowana.

protectionProvider
ProtectedConfigurationProvider

Obiekt zawierający dostawców, którzy szyfrują i odszyfrują chronione dane konfiguracji.

protectedConfigSection
ProtectedConfigurationSection

Obiekt, który zapewnia programowy dostęp do configProtectedData sekcji konfiguracji.

Zwraca

Ciąg reprezentujący zaszyfrowaną sekcję obiektu konfiguracji.

Implementuje

Dotyczy